The new Coveralls background stamps are lots of fun and they are HUGE ~ a 5 3/4" square.   I love it because they cover an entire card front, but it can be hard to stamp something that large.  Well I've got an easy tip for you... use your acrylic plates from your die cutting machine (Cuttlebug, Big Shot, etc).  They work GREAT (thanks Taylor).  Also, ink your large image by laying your stamp on a flat surface and then holding your ink pad.  You'll be able to see the image better and get full coverage.
